Physical Failure Analysis (PFA) supports root cause analysis through physical FA on reliability fails on Intel's latest technology node for process certification as well as product qualification. We are part of Corporate Quality Network (CQN) Labs. We work in a state-of-the-art Failure Analysis (FA) lab equipped with several dual-beam tools, PFIBs, Scanning Electron Microscopes, and other de-processing and imaging tools.


PFA is responsible for all physical FA that also includes sample prep. We support sample prep for TEM imaging, nano-probing, and fault isolation. PFA team is a good mix of experienced PFA techs and engineers working in shifts, providing 24x7 support. We have an opening for an Engineering Technology Development (TD) Manager. The Manager will initially be expected to focus on TEM prep training of new hires, TEM prep logistics and operations, TEM prep development, and automation strategy with a possible increase in scope in time.
